This Gospel truth is probably the most misunderstood. Many people will never grasp this, nor see the reason why it is possible. That is because imputed righteousness simply blows the mind of many.

The Bible says that we are justified by GRACE through FAITH, and that not of ourselves. It is the GIFT of God, not of works, let any man should boast (Eph 2:8,9). So when a sinner is justified God declares that person to be righteous, and also imputes the righteousness of Christ to that person. And it is only on the basis of the righteousness of Christ that any person can enter Heaven.

Of course, there is much more to salvation, but for many here imputed righteousness is a stumbling block, just like it was to many Jews. That is because it is incompatible with human reasoning. Only the Holy Spirit can show spiritual things to the spiritual person.
